✨Tip Number 1

Make sure to research the company before your interview. Knowing their values and what they do will help you stand out and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

✨Tip Number 2

Practice common interview questions with a friend or in front of a mirror. This will help you feel more confident and articulate when it’s your turn to shine.

✨Tip Number 3

Dress appropriately for the interview. Even if the job is casual, looking smart shows that you respect the opportunity and are serious about landing the job.

✨Tip Number 4

Don’t forget to follow up after your interview! A quick thank-you message can leave a lasting impression and keep you on their radar.
